How to succeed in launching a new application when there are so many representatives with competitive solutions? It might be surprising, but common practice to follow good market examples can be turned to your advantage. Indeed, the experience gained by others can enlighten your project from different perspectives and brainstorm ideas for better product implementation. In this article, we’re going to consider the known Flutter apps examples and learn how your team can benefit from them.
List of the Content
WHAT IS FLUTTER
The app market has tremendously changed over recent years. The fast technology advancement and increasing market demand supported a wide adoption of app solutions across all industries. It’s hard to find a company that hasn’t considered app development for their business needs. Even though applications vary due to the project specification, all teams have to undergo the development process and find the best approaches for product implementation.
Technology choice becomes one of the decisive aspects here. The good tech stack enables great functionality, team productivity, fast implementation, smooth performance, easier maintenance, etc. The technology stack can’t be chosen without a comprehensive requirements analysis. The well-outlined functional and non-functional requirements help to make a deliberate decision corresponding to project specifications. At the same time, teams have to check on the market tendencies and learn what technologies have a promising future.
Staying up-to-date is definitely among the top requirements. Companies need to be aware of all the latest advancements and follow the best practices. Talking about app development, many teams discover the opportunity of cross-platform development. It allows them to build apps for different platforms from a single codebase. The cross-platform solutions have fastly gained popularity on the market. More and more teams started to leverage this approach for their needs.
Considering the cross-platform development, Flutter remains among the top representatives in this domain. This technology is worth special attention due to the numerous benefits it introduces on the market. Flutter easily becomes a game changer in advancing app development. The number of projects built with Flutter is increasing rapidly, and it gets the point of more than 500k Flutter apps. And it’s without mentioning that the technology is relatively new on the market.
What is Flutter?
Flutter is an open-source, cross-platform framework that supports the development of mobile, web, desktop and embedded applications. It makes it possible to deploy to multiple platforms while maintaining a single codebase.
Moreover, the fast framework development adds a broader perspective. Over a really short period, Flutter has opened so many opportunities for creating advanced apps. In fact, the beta release was only suitable for Android app development. However, from the very beginning, the Flutter team’s goal was to introduce a framework that could enable Android and iOS app development. The first stable version of Flutter was released in December 2018 and already had the support for both platforms. From that moment on, the cross-platform framework continues to introduce innovative functionality. What’s more, the team has done everything to support web, desktop and embedded app development. It becomes possible to maintain a single codebase and allows developers to deploy apps to multiple platforms. From the latest updates, it was the introduction of Flutter 3 in May 2022. It added stable support for Linux and macOS applications and introduced the Casual Games Toolkit to launch Flutter games.
The framework advancement is also explained by great support on the market. Both businesses and developers have become interested in apps that use Flutter as they can gain numerous benefits from this cross-platform solution. Flutter keeps on strengthening its market position. It gathers a huge community that reaches the number of more than 3M developers. Besides, the framework belongs to the most used and loved frameworks applied in app development.
WHY DO FLUTTER APPS BECOME SO POPULAR?
Considering the popularity of this framework, we won’t be able to skip the question of how apps built with Flutter become that popular. It isn’t hard to find various Flutter apps examples and notice how fastly they spread on the market. Even the fact that the technology is new to the market doesn’t make it less attractive for developers and businesses.
The main thing is that it has everything required for efficient app development and continuously keeps on introducing innovative tools and features. Apps made with Flutter are known for excellent functionality, impressive designs, and fast performance. Besides, developers acknowledge many benefits within the development process, including the shortened timeline and cost savings. Let’s proceed with more details on the advantages businesses can get with apps built with Flutter.
- Open-source ecosystem
The Flutter team focuses on building a strong and open-source ecosystem. It’s a known fact that this technology was created and supported by Google. But they encourage contributions from developers from all over the world. It enables to become one of the largest communities on the market. Flutter developers have access to more than 19k packages, plugins, tools, and integrations. It definitely provides the solid base to introduce advanced apps built with Flutter.
- Native performance
Looking through Flutter apps examples, it’s worth noting the excellent performance and extensive functionality presented for users. They have no problem competing with solutions implemented with native development approaches. Flutter introduces all the necessary functionality and tools to transform the user experience for the better. High app performance becomes another great advantage when choosing this framework for the next project.
- Increased productivity
The team can’t forget about productivity when looking for a great technology for app development. It influences not only the process efficiency but the final product results. This framework is fast to learn and simple to use due to core tech specifications. Extensive documentation, regular updates, and detailed tutorials are highly valued among developers. Besides, the team can leverage a variety of DevTools to enhance workflows and support productivity.
- Beautiful designs
If the team drives a special focus on the app design, this technology presents a winning solution. It isn’t surprising that the market is full of beautiful Flutter apps examples as they apply the best designs. The main goal of Flutter is to make the application feel and look great on every platform. Adaptive and responsive approaches in design help to deliver beautiful looks and excessive user experience within Flutter apps.
- Large community
The supportive community often becomes a decisive aspect of technology advancement. The Flutter’s success also relies on the tremendous support from the developers’ community and Google. It enabled the introduction of an open and reliable framework. Besides, it won’t be difficult to find Flutter developers as their number is constantly increasing. Many businesses find such cooperation really advantageous as they can keep pace with the latest market trends.
- Cost savings
Last but not least is the opportunity to make savings simple and convenient. As long as the companies decide to build Flutter apps, they can count on quicker time-to-market and simplified maintenance. The teams don’t have to deliver separate apps for each platform, thus reducing development time and costs. Besides, maintaining a single app version is always more cost-effective. It makes Flutter a reasonable choice while covering all rising needs.
FLUTTER APPS EXAMPLES
Regardless of business specifications, companies look for efficient ways to advance internal operations and customer experience. App development becomes an excellent solution to introduce the required functionality and meet outlined needs. Along with leveraging Flutter, the team can introduce the full-fledged solution to multiple platforms. It is a great opportunity to build a single codebase application compatible with mobile, desktop, or embedded devices.
When considering Flutter for your project, it’ll be interesting to find the answer to such a question as “What apps are made with Flutter?”. It covers a good market practice of gaining valuable experience from other representatives and their successful product stories. Before we proceed with Flutter apps examples, it’s worth emphasizing the fact that this technology has been favoured by both big aggregators and new market players. It meets the team’s every need, including a smooth development process and exceptional functionality.
Google Ads Mobile App
The first Flutter app example to start will be the Google Ads mobile application. Since Flutter is developed and supported by Google, it’s definitely interesting to see how they use this technology for their needs. The online advertising platform Google Ads has delivered a full-fledged mobile application to meet customer needs on the go.
As a result, Google Ads is also a business mobile application built by Google LLC. The primary focus was on providing on-the-go functionality to stay connected with advertising campaigns within a few taps on the smartphone. The app focus followed such business needs as enhanced flexibility and extended user experience. It goes without saying that mobile presence refers to a must-have requirement. Customers are looking for the convenience of doing different tasks, whether business operations or daily activities.
The Google Ads team has presented the full set of features to manage ad performance and optimize campaigns via mobile devices. It becomes an efficient tool for business and marketing managers to stay connected anytime. The core application’s functionality includes:
- Account management
- Real-time ad campaign tracking
- Campaign optimization
- Performance management
- Explore functionality
- Status changes
- Various type campaigns
- Billing and payments
This Flutter app example covers all the necessary functionality to run successful ad campaigns. The main idea is that the user can switch between devices without losing performance track and optimizing the campaign when required.
The Google Ads team has reached its primary need of providing a full-fledged mobile solution to enhance customer experience. Leveraging Flutter, they launched a mobile application for App Store and Google Play and kept increasing their audience. Only the number of downloads in Google Play reaches more than 10M.
Following such a Flutter app example, it becomes clear that Flutter is a great choice for complex solutions that deal with large data sets and get the best functionality. Businesses have to be aware that Flutter is definitely a solution to enable continued scalability. The teams won’t have any problems with rising demand as they can adopt the solution according to their project-specific needs.
It’s always interesting to discover how business needs vary from project to project. Some teams try to extend the existing solutions, whereas others keep on reinventing traditional services. In this case, we can consider one of the following Flutter apps examples like Nubank, a game-changer for the finance industry outside Asia.
That is a known provider of digital banking services that mainly operates in such countries as Brazil, Columbia, and Mexico. Nubank users have the great opportunity to complete various financial operations just within the mobile application. Banking beyond traditional institutions might be new to the market, but it has definitely changed user expectations. It’s an exceptional opportunity to handle most banking transactions with a few taps. As for the app functionalities, Nubank users are offered:
- Digital accounts
- Credit cards
- Business accounts
- Life insurance
- Personal loans
- NuTap for contactless payments
Currently, the number of Nubank customers reaches more than 50M and continuously grows. Fast advancements and regular updates help the team to deliver the best functionality and user experience for their customers. At the same time, this Flutter app example shows how everything can be advanced with the right technology choice and how important it remains to stay up-to-date.
Interested in how to build a cutting-edge application for the fintech industry?
You can check our latest comprehensive guide that describes core features, the development process, and business models commonly used for applications like Revolut.
The development history of the Nubank app is quite interesting. And what’s more, that wasn’t a Flutter application from the very beginning. In 2013, the team started with iOS and Android apps built with Swift and Kotlin. Native development approaches were the only option, as hybrid frameworks lacked functionality at that moment. At the same time, the Nubank team was always open to changes and ready to experiment with other technologies.
With the company’s growth, the development team continued to experiment with different alternatives. For example, they also used React Native to advance user accounts. It was a great success that proved the advantages of hybrid technologies. Later they conducted an internal research project and evaluated technologies by many criteria like viability, cost, development risks, etc. To their surprise, Flutter was a definite winner and became the primary mobile technology for Nubank solutions. All the upcoming functionalities were agreed to develop with Flutter, as well as the legacy features migrated over time.
This great Flutter app example shows how it becomes important to stay flexible. It covers the opportunity to develop successful products while using best practices on the market. Flutter offers numerous off-the-box solutions to streamline development and support the best performance.
Discussing what apps use Flutter also impresses with the amazing application variety. It is interesting to find out how the technology is adopted in different categories and to project specifications. Flutter attracts the attention of both well-established representatives and new market players. This cross-platform framework provides equal opportunities to quickly enter the market with a valuable product.
Another great Flutter app example is Reflectly, the journal app for self-care and mental health improvement. It embraces the full set of features to improve mood, reduce anxiety, practice mindfulness, etc. The app idea is based on connecting best psychology practices and the latest technology advancements. Moreover, Reflectly driven by AI helps to reflect thoughts and improve mood. The core functionality of Reflectly covers:
- Digital diary
- Personal journaling companion
- Intelligent questions
- Daily quotes
- Motivation challenges
- Mood tracker
- Personalized insights and reminders
Reflectly team has managed to build a supportive environment for a large audience. Besides, the application is getting great recognition on the market. The effectiveness of using this app has also been affirmed by a number of experts, including the best therapists and psychologists.
It’s great to see how the new market players can share their success stories. Starting with just two developers, the team delivered the initial product version for iOS and Android users in less than three months. Flutter allowed them to decrease development time by 50% as well as present required functionality. It was a revelation for the team that they could advance their solutions so fast.
Another distinguishing characteristic of Flutter apps examples is the beautiful design. And for Reflectly, it was a decisive criterion. The entire app concept was built upon impressive designs and a unique user experience. From the beginning, the team was looking for a tech solution that could make a difference to the product. Flutter enabled them to implement all the initial ideas and not to worry about how to adapt to the unique characteristics of each platform. That’s a win-win solution to cover both functional and non-functional requirements. Flutter has become a good choice to present consistent, personalized designs to millions of users across different platforms. Moreover, the latest technology releases cover the ability to advance the solution, including web support.
Considering such examples of Flutter apps, teams can be aware that there’s always a way to build a good product. The main thing is just to carefully specify the needs and select the right tools to implement them. The exceptional app functionality, beautiful designs, and unique user experience can definitely beat the strongest market competition.
Have a great app idea?
Get an expert consultation with Existek. We are a professional software development company that will gladly share our first-hand experience to meet your project needs.
The interesting thing about Flutter development is also the way how companies address their business-specific needs. If some teams work on extending existing solutions, others just start from scratch. Though, as the experience shows, the app introduction seizes the opportunity to extend the brand and engage with your customers in a totally new way.
We’d like to take one of the excellent Flutter apps examples that managed to present their services from a completely different perspective. Hamilton is an entertainment app built by the known musical theatre in New York. The app’s success was supported by the deliberate decision of the team to find new ways to get engaged with the theatre fans. It’s impossible to deny the fact that customer expectations have drastically changed over recent years. User engagement is a decisive aspect of establishing audience loyalty.
It’s amazing how adopting the Hamilton app allowed the company to expand the brand beyond the stage. The introduced functionality focuses on entertaining fans and giving them access to other theatre-related things anytime they want. Besides entertaining purposes, they embrace eCommerce practices. For instance, users have the opportunity to purchase tickets for upcoming events or buy merchandise from the Hamilton store. To discover the variety of features delivered for this Flutter app example, you can check the following list:
- Hamilton news, including video content
- Trivia game
- #HamCam to make selfie photos
- Sticker packs
- Treasury for exclusive customer offers
The Hamilton app idea is a perfect example of how businesses always have opportunities for growth. It’s definitely worth the effort to try something new and keep on expanding your solutions. As for Hamilton, it was the decision to build an app while meeting the additional needs of their fans. They acknowledge that choosing Flutter was the best decision for them. The development team managed to launch the app within three months after they wrote the first code line. The technology choice was right in every possible term. It embraced the project requirements related to performance, visual look, productivity, etc.
Apps written in Flutter prove that this framework is suitable for teams with high expectations of quality. It corresponds to the need to build cutting-edge solutions and maximize productivity. Delivering exceptional customer experience has definitely advanced with the opportunities provided by Flutter. In order to withstand the market competition, companies have to encourage growth, optimize business processes and enhance better engagement with their customers.
Discovering great Flutter apps examples helps to understand better how to look at the technology from different perspectives:
- It’s about the possibility of delivering advanced products regardless of platform specifications.
- Apps written in Flutter can suit the needs of various industries.
- Flutter has a promising future to advance app development to a new level.
From our experience, we can say that Flutter has also become a primary choice for some applications built for our clients. The comprehensive requirements analysis and learning of the market tendencies help us to remain quite demanding. The technology stack has always been a decisive aspect of the overall process efficiency. Flutter gives the unique possibility to meet functional and non-functional requirements quickly and efficiently. We stick to strong principles in delivering the best solutions and meeting customer needs.
Prismatext is among Flutter mobile apps that would get your attention. That is an innovative mobile application powered by AI to learn new languages while reading a book. Our client, Prismatext, was looking for an efficient solution to extend user experience and develop a full-fledged mobile solution. The application built with Flutter covered new business opportunities and exceptional functionality to meet customer needs.
The core idea of Prismatext is to support language learning when blending foreign words into the text. This learning method is known as the Diglot Weave technique and has proven to be 50% more effective than other practice methods. The Prismatext users have access to the following features implemented within an app:
- User account
- Book catalogue
- Advanced e-reader
- Customized reader appearance
- Foreign words density switch
- Offline reading
- Accessibility features
Well-outlined project requirements and open communication enabled a clear understanding of the project needs. In collaboration with Existek’s team, Prismatext delivered all the outlined functionality to support efficient learning approaches. Our task was to find the technology that could support native performance and be suitable for fast app delivery. It’s also great that Flutter mobile apps are easy to maintain.
This technology’s popularity is growing day by day. Businesses and developers find Flutter efficient for a variety of use cases. As it always leaves space for improvements, teams gain all the necessary tools for further updates and integrations. Today’s market is full of successful Flutter apps examples, including mobile, web, desktop and embedded solutions. Leveraging Flutter for your business can be a good decision as there is no limitation due to platform specifications.
Want to check on other projects from Existek?
We are ready to share our software development experience with you. Our company provides full-cycle services to exceed customer expectations while presenting valuable market products.
When the teams share their development stories, they also gain a new perspective on the product vision. It often helps to come up with some ideas and oversee the market expectations. In fact, this efficient practice allows them to exchange ideas as well as learn from valuable insights. Technology choice has always been among the top priorities in delivering great software solutions. And Flutter is definitely rocking the market at present. Considering the popular Flutter apps examples, teams have the chance to broaden their experience and get useful hints for the next project implementation. It provides a better overview of market demand and helps to impose the right requirements for your product development.
Interested in developing your next project with Flutter?
As a software development company with a decade-long experience building cutting-edge solutions, Existek also specializes in Flutter development and knows how to address your business needs with it.
Why choose Flutter?
Flutter is an open-source, cross-platform framework to build the application regardless of platform specifications. It introduces such benefits as fast development, functionality, productivity, and cost reduction.
What are other popular apps built with Flutter?
Among the Flutter apps examples, you can find solutions delivered by:
What are the main benefits of Flutter apps?
Developers favour the opportunity to deploy apps to multiple platforms while maintaining a single code base. Besides, apps made with Flutter are fast to deliver and know for great performance and beautiful designs.
How to learn from the experience of other apps that use Flutter?
Analyzing good market practices can enlighten your project idea and bring new perspectives. The teams have an excellent opportunity to learn from experience gained by others and adapt it to their business-specific needs.